Solution Overview
Problem
Debit card users face substantial withdrawal fees when using ATMs not affiliated with their financial institution, leading to customer dissatisfaction and increased costs for financial institutions.
Innovation Solution
A system and method that allows debit card holders to direct refund payments of withdrawal fees to various accounts, such as savings or investment accounts, through an interoperable account servicing system and automatic teller machine network, enabling customers to choose the destination of fee refunds and potentially directing them to investment accounts or rewards programs.

Data Source
AI summary
A debit-card withdrawal-fee payment method includes receiving selection of a first account to which withdrawal-fee payments are to be directed, receiving notification of a debit-card transaction withdrawal-fee amount associated with a second account, and making a withdrawal-fee payment to the first account in the withdrawal-fee amount.
